Originally Posted by GOAT35
QUICK QUESTION
has anyone found a cheaper solution that the Viper for an Remote start??
My issues
-Don't want to spend over $250 overall
-Rather install myself
-Don't want to lose a key!
-Need to maintain FOB functions "windows down"
PS I remember reading about one that offed a windows up function as well"
THANKS
right off the bat you need a bypass module, that runs a normal $75. There is no work around that. Now you need a remote starter system, thats up to you how much $$$. Wire up a anti-grind relay for the starter.

Since you want to install yourself you dont have to pay labor you should be under $250 pending cost or alarm. I would look at basic 2 way system. Viper 5301 they can be had for under $100.

-how do you get to the bulb in the trunk i wanna replace it with an LED and i cant figure out how to get to it. (cant find a DIY)
Go to the trunk, look for the light bulb there is a little plastic dome over the bulb, there is a plastic latch on the side. Unlatch it and take out the bulb.

The same bulb that's in the clear corners/License plate lights can be used
